﻿
input {

}

h1, h2, h3, h4, h5 {

}

/* Button Adjustments */
.btn {

}

.btn-primary {
}

    .btn-primary:hover {

    }

.btn-secondary {

}

    .btn-secondary:hover {
    }

.btn-default {

}

    .btn-default:hover {

    }


/* Form Input Adjustments */
.form-control, input[type=text], input[type=tel], input[type=date], input[type=datetime], input[type=datetime-local], input[type=email], input[type=number], input[type=month], input[type=range], input[type=search], textarea, select {
    width: 100%;
    border: none !important;
    border-bottom: 1px solid rgb(215, 215, 215) !important;
    box-shadow: none !important;
    border-radius: 0px !important;
    padding-left: 0px !important;
    font-size: 16px !important;
    padding-bottom: 10px !important;
    margin-bottom: 40px !important;
    padding-left: 0px !important;
    height: 42px !important;
    background: #fff !important;
    z-index: 5;
    position: relative !important;
    background: transparent !important
}

/* Form Structure */
.assessment-header {

}

.tco-image {

}

.question-text {

}

.info-icon > i {

}

.advanced-label {

}

.advanced-section-header {

}

    .advanced-section-header .icon-holder {

    }

/* Result Page */
.result-top-container {

}

    .result-top-container > .container > .row > .col-md-6 > h1.assessment-sub-header {

    }

        .result-top-container > .container > .row > .col-md-6 > h1.assessment-sub-header > img.assessment-sub-header-img {

        }

    .result-top-container .big-value-header {

    }

    .result-top-container .small-value-header {

    }
#get-report-btn {
    width: 315px !important;
    max-width: 315px !important;
}
/* Lead Form */
.lead-form-header {

}

.modal-dialog, .modal-content {

}

#form-container {

}

.modal-content {
    border: 1px solid rgba(0,0,0,.03) !important;
    box-shadow: 0 2px 2px rgba(0,0,0,.24), 0 0 2px rgba(0,0,0,.12) !important;
    margin: 4px !important;
    border-radius: 0px !important;
    padding: 16px !important;
}

#form-container {

}

.lead-form-header {
    text-align: center;
}

.form-control-lead, input.form-control-lead[type=text], input.form-control-lead[type=tel], input.form-control-lead[type=date], input.form-control-lead[type=datetime], input.form-control-lead[type=datetime-local], input.form-control-lead[type=email], input.form-control-lead[type=number], input.form-control-lead[type=month], input.form-control-lead[type=range], input.form-control-lead[type=search], textarea.form-control-lead, select.form-control-lead {
    width: 100%;
    border: none !important;
    border-bottom: 1px solid rgb(215, 215, 215) !important;
    box-shadow: none !important;
    border-radius: 0px !important;
    padding-left: 0px !important;
    font-size: 16px !important;
    padding-bottom: 10px !important;
    margin-bottom: 40px !important;
    padding-left: 0px !important;
    height: 42px !important;
    background: #fff !important;
    z-index: 5;
    position: relative !important;
    background: transparent !important
}
.last-input {
    margin-bottom: 24px;
}

.lead-gen-btn {
    display: block;
    margin: auto;
}

.lead-validator {
    margin-top: -40px !important;
    padding-bottom: 40px !important;
    float: right !important;
    font-size: 12px !important;
    color: #a94442;
}